When using Calc, I like to navigate across the cells using the arrow keys on the keyboard. I'm finding when I do this on my Linux system, the longer I'm in the spreadsheet, the slower my navigation becomes. After a while, there's a large delay when I press one of the arrow keys. Eventually, the spreadsheet becomes all but unusable. My spreadsheets are not large; as spreadsheets go, they are quite simple. And, the behavior doesn't immediately happen. When I first load a spreadsheet file, the navigation is immediate. It slows down as I use the file, even if all I'm doing is navigating with arrow keys.
I dual boot Windows 10 and Ubuntu Mate 14.04LTS. On the Windows 10 side of things, I'm using LO 5.2.x and on the Linux side, I'm using LO 5.1.6.2. This behavior only happens on the Linux side of things. Has anyone else experienced anything like this?
